Fig 5. Gut microbiota determines severity of myocardial infarction.
A. Antibiotics added to the drinking water reduced infarct size (IS) in vivo. B. Antibiotics added directly to the coronary circulation of isolated hearts did not reduce IS in vitro. C. Antibiotics added to the drinking water and then excluded from the coronary circulation of isolated hearts reduced IS. Data are means ± SD; n = 6/group. AAR, area at risk. LV, left ventricle. Reduction in infarct size was similar for in vitro and in vivo studies (A, C). *P < 0.01 vs. control.
